Ovid (recorded in Fasti, 5) recounts how the festival Floralias was discontinued; but following a succession of poor or failing blossoms, Floralias was resurrected in 173 BC and celebrated annually thereafter. Flora was consort to Favonius, the wind god. To symbolise fertility in honour of Flora, hares and deer (or goats depending on the translation of Caprae/Capreae - the former being the plural of a female goat and the latter the plural of a roe-deer) were released in the Circus Maximus. From April 28th to May 3rd, the Floralia were traditionally celebrated with dances, floral offerings, and chariot races. The Floralia took place during the five days between April 28 and May 3. A further symbol of fertility was the throwing of garbanzo beans (chickpeas) to the audiences in the Circus. She was originally the Goddess specifically of the flowering crops, such as the grain or fruit-trees, and Her function was to make the grain, vegetables and trees bloom so that autumns harvest would be good. Feronia was a Goddess of Spring flowers and woods (also associated with Flora) and, although this day was named for her, it became a day of recognition for Juno, Minerva and Jupiter. These two words represent the animal and plant kingdom, and are rarely used separately. In 173 b.c.e., the Senate reinstated the holiday, and renamed it the Ludi Floralis, which included public games and theatrical performances. RAINN: The nation's largest anti-sexual violence organization. Floralias was a public festival (ferias publicae) and took commenced on 28 Apr (Julian calendar), until 3 May. As Flora was originally a Sabine Goddess, and as the Sabines were a neighboring tribe whom the Romans conquered and assimilated into Rome, perhaps this is an acknowledgement of the land so acquired, put into legendary terms. At the festival, with the men decked in flowers, and the women wearing normally forbidden gay costumes, five days of farces and mimes were enacted ithyphallic,[6] and including nudity when called for[7] followed by a sixth day of the hunting of goats and hares. Juno was stricken with jealousy after Jupiter gave birth to Minerva without her, so Flora gifted Juno with an enchanted flower that would allow her to conceive without a father. While she was otherwise a relatively minor figure in Roman mythology, being one among several fertility goddesses, her association with the spring gave her particular importance at the coming of springtime,[2] as did her role as goddess of youth. Flora was depicted by the Romans wearing light spring clothing, holding small bouquets of flowers, sometimes crowned with blossoms. Titus Tatius (according to tradition, the Sabine king who ruled with Romulus) is said to have introduced her cult to Rome; her temple stood near the Circus Maximus. Flora had two temples in Rome, one near the Circus Maximus, the great stadium of Rome where chariot races were held, and another on the slopes of the Quirinal Hill.
